About 2 months ago I put super low rear king springs in my 1990 Vn wagon. I think they've settled by now as the car is noticeably a little lower than stock. I want to go lower and am thinking of going a set of springs lower. However I have a pair of MONROE GT GAS LOWERED REAR SHOCKS that i haven't yet put in my VN with its king springs. if the Monroes make it sit just that little bit lower ill be happy and won't need new springs...will this be the case if i put the shortened shocks in???

shortened shocks dont make your car lower, they just trap the spring in so it doesnt fall out... i have the same problem with my vn it has ultra lows, and i thought it would sit alot lower than what it does. if your really keen on lowering it more take out the rubber spring seats. its dirty but will give you about another half an inch lower.

shockers do not adjust the height of a ride, springs do, get lower springs & you need to have matching shocks depending on the spring load or else your shocks wont last long, they will leak eventually.
